2023-02-03hw/arm/virt: Consolidate GIC finalize logicAlexander Graf
Up to now, the finalize_gic_version() code open coded what is essentially a support bitmap match between host/emulation environment and desired target GIC type. This open coding leads to undesirable side effects. For example, a VM with KVM and -smp 10 will automatically choose GICv3 while the same command line with TCG will stay on GICv2 and fail the launch. This patch combines the TCG and KVM matching code paths by making everything a 2 pass process. First, we determine which GIC versions the current environment is able to support, then we go through a single state machine to determine which target GIC mode that means for us. After this patch, the only user noticable changes should be consolidated error messages as well as TCG -M virt supporting -smp > 8 automatically. 2022-12-15hw/arm/virt: Improve high memory region address assignmentGavin Shan
There are three high memory regions, which are VIRT_HIGH_REDIST2, VIRT_HIGH_PCIE_ECAM and VIRT_HIGH_PCIE_MMIO. Their base addresses are floating on highest RAM address. However, they can be disabled in several cases. (1) One specific high memory region is likely to be disabled by code by toggling vms->highmem_{redists, ecam, mmio}. (2) VIRT_HIGH_PCIE_ECAM region is disabled on machine, which is 'virt-2.12' or ealier than it. (3) VIRT_HIGH_PCIE_ECAM region is disabled when firmware is loaded on 32-bits system. (4) One specific high memory region is disabled when it breaks the PA space limit. The current implementation of virt_set_{memmap, high_memmap}() isn't optimized because the high memory region's PA space is always reserved, regardless of whatever the actual state in the corresponding vms->highmem_{redists, ecam, mmio} flag. In the code, 'base' and 'vms->highest_gpa' are always increased for case (1), (2) and (3). It's unnecessary since the assigned PA space for the disabled high memory region won't be used afterwards. Improve the address assignment for those three high memory region by skipping the address assignment for one specific high memory region if it has been disabled in case (1), (2) and (3). The memory layout may be changed after the improvement is applied, which leads to potential migration breakage. So 'vms->highmem_compact' is added to control if the improvement should be applied. For now, 'vms->highmem_compact' is set to false, meaning that we don't have memory layout change until it becomes configurable through property 'compact-highmem' in next patch. 2022-05-19hw/arm/virt: Fix incorrect non-secure flash dtb node namePeter Maydell
In the virt board with secure=on we put two nodes in the dtb for flash devices: one for the secure-only flash, and one for the non-secure flash. We get the reg properties for these correct, but in the DT node name, which by convention includes the base address of devices, we used the wrong address. Fix it. Spotted by dtc, which will complain Warning (unique_unit_address): /flash@0: duplicate unit-address (also used in node /secflash@0) if you dump the dtb from QEMU with -machine dumpdtb=file.dtb and then decompile it with dtc. 2022-04-22hw/arm/virt: Support TCG GICv4Peter Maydell
Add support for the TCG GICv4 to the virt board. For the board, the GICv4 is very similar to the GICv3, with the only difference being the size of the redistributor frame. The changes here are thus: * calculating virt_redist_capacity correctly for GICv4 * changing various places which were "if GICv3" to be "if not GICv2" * the commandline option handling Note that using GICv4 reduces the maximum possible number of CPUs on the virt board from 512 to 317, because we can now only fit half as many redistributors into the redistributor regions we have defined. 2022-04-22hw/arm/virt: Abstract out calculation of redistributor region capacityPeter Maydell
In several places in virt.c we calculate the number of redistributors that fit in a region of our memory map, which is the size of the region divided by the size of a single redistributor frame. For GICv4, the redistributor frame is a different size from that for GICv3. Abstract out the calculation of redistributor region capacity so that we have one place we need to change to handle GICv4 rather than several. 2022-04-21hw/arm/virt: Check for attempt to use TrustZone with KVM or HVFPeter Maydell
It's not possible to provide the guest with the Security extensions (TrustZone) when using KVM or HVF, because the hardware virtualization extensions don't permit running EL3 guest code. However, we weren't checking for this combination, with the result that QEMU would assert if you tried it: $ qemu-system-aarch64 -enable-kvm -machine virt,secure=on -cpu host -display none Unexpected error in object_property_find_err() at ../../qom/object.c:1304: qemu-system-aarch64: Property 'host-arm-cpu.secure-memory' not found Aborted Check for this combination of options and report an error, in the same way we already do for attempts to give a KVM or HVF guest the Virtualization or MTE extensions.
